Output 44a2ecbaa78e3ccbb165cfbddd2d88afeddaebd962a18f7cedeb3f8fa39131e2:3

value
1026978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72f1b30972821e54cb59bdef3138d7b633057480 OP_EQUAL
address
3CAnVyi9sFtM8QG1iD6Ksj1NeqcwgVxQnS
transaction
44a2ecbaa78e3ccbb165cfbddd2d88afeddaebd962a18f7cedeb3f8fa39131e2
confirmations
301917
spent
true